How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Marriottsville?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Marriottsville Studio Apartments | $1,305 | $1,203 | $1,408 |
| Marriottsville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,746 | $1,060 | $6,389 |
| Marriottsville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,093 | $1,280 | $10,000+ |
| Marriottsville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,329 | $1,515 | $10,000+ |
| Marriottsville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,739 | $7,739 | $7,739 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Marriottsville
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Marriottsville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Marriottsville ranges from $1,060 to $6,389 with an average monthly rent of $1,746.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Marriottsville c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Marriottsville range from $1,280 to $11,100.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,093.
How expensive are Marriottsville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Marriottsville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,515 to $12,096 - averaging $2,329 for the location.
